Concrete Driveway Sealing in Alpharetta, GA
Concrete driveway sealing services involve applying a protective coating to the surface of a concrete driveway to help preserve its condition and appearance. This process is suitable for a variety of projects, including residential driveways, parking areas, and walkways. Sealing helps to prevent damage from water, stains, and other environmental elements, extending the lifespan of the concrete while maintaining a clean and attractive look. Property owners often seek this service to safeguard their investment, improve curb appeal, and reduce the need for costly repairs in the future.
Before requesting concrete driveway sealing, property owners typically want to understand the current condition of their driveway, including any existing cracks or surface damage that may need attention beforehand. It’s also important to consider the type of sealer used, as different formulations offer varying levels of protection and finish.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and repairing cracks, is essential for optimal results. Consulting with a professional can help determine the best sealing options based on the driveway’s material, age, and local climate conditions.

Concrete Driveway Sealing Questions
What is driveway sealing? Driveway s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face to help prevent damage from weather, stains, and wear.
Why should homeowners seal their concrete driveway?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the driveway and maintains its appearance by preventing cracks and stains.
When is the best time to seal a concrete driveway? The ideal time is during warm, dry weather when the surface is clean and free of moisture.
How often should a concrete driveway be sealed? Typically, sealing every 2 to 3 years helps maintain protection and appearance.
